on 05/13/2009 03:42 PM Daniel Leidert said the following:
> Am Dienstag, den 12.05.2009, 23:20 -0300 schrieb Manuel Lemos:
> 
>> I updated my server that had OpenSuse 9 to OpenSuSE 11. Now browsing
>> repository file listing gives the error message "Failed to spawn GNU
>> rlog". I already checked that rcs package is installed in one of the
>> lookup directories of the command_path array. Running the rlog from the
>> command line works well. What else could be causing this error message?
> 
> Could be http://bugs.debian.org/483442. The related patch can be seen
> here:
> http://patch-tracking.debian.net/patch/series/view/cvsweb/3:3.0.6-5/10_483442_fix_perl_510_test_failure.
> 
> But this is just one possibility.

Yes, that was it. Thanks for the hint.
